Comparison Summary

Okay, let's dive into a detailed comparison of the Realme 9i and the Samsung Galaxy M53. I'll break down the specs, explain their real-world implications, and help you figure out which phone might be the better fit for you.

1. Specifications Breakdown

FeatureRealme 9iSamsung Galaxy M53Real-World Implications
Design
Dimensions (mm)164.4 x 75.7 x 8.4164.7 x 77 x 7.4M53 is slightly wider and thinner, 9i is a bit more compact and thicker.
Weight (g)190176M53 is noticeably lighter for easier handling.
Display
Size (inches)6.66.7M53 offers slightly larger viewing area.
Resolution1080x24121080x2408Both are sharp, differences are imperceptible.
PPI400394Both offer excellent clarity.
TechnologyIPS LCDAMOLEDM53's AMOLED offers richer colors, deeper blacks, and better power efficiency.
Refresh Rate (Hz)90120M53 provides smoother scrolling and animations.
Brightness (nits)00Brightness data missing, making comparison impossible
Performance
ChipsetSnapdragon 680Dimensity 900M53's chip is significantly faster, providing better performance for gaming and multitasking.
AnTuTu Score216,850500,100M53 is much more powerful for demanding apps and games.
GPUAdreno 610Mali-G68 MC4M53 has a more capable GPU for graphics-intensive tasks.
Camera
Rear Main (MP)50108M53 captures much more detail and sharper photos.
Main Sensor Size1/2.76"1/1.67"M53's larger sensor gathers more light, resulting in better low-light photos.
Front Camera (MP)1632M53 captures more detailed selfies.
Wide Angle CameraNone8MPM53 offers a wider perspective for landscape and group shots.
Portrait (Depth)None2MPM53 provides better background blur for portrait photos.
Macro Lens (MP)22Similar close-up capabilities on both.
B&W Lens (MP)2None9i has a dedicated B&W camera for monochrome effects.
Video Recording1080p@30fps4K@30fpsM53 records higher resolution and sharper videos.
Battery Life
Capacity (mAh)50005000Both should offer similar battery life.
Charging (W)33259i charges faster, minimizing downtime.
Charger IncludedIncludedNot includedRealme gives you everything you need in the box.
Software
OSAndroid 11 (upgradable to 13)Android 12 (upgradable to 13)M53 has a newer operating system out of the box.
Storage
Internal Storage64GB or 128GB128GB or 256GBM53 offers more internal storage which will be important if you take a lot of photos and videos.
RAM4GB or 6GB6GB or 8GBM53 allows smoother multitasking with the option for more RAM.
ExpandableNoNoNeither phones have expandable storage.
Audio
Audio QualityHi-Res, StereoDolby Atmos, StereoBoth have stereo sound. The 9i has Hi-Res while the M53 has Dolby Atmos.
Security
Fingerprint sensorside-mountedside-mountedBoth have side-mounted fingerprint readers.
Connectivity
Bluetooth Version5.05.2M53 uses the more advanced Bluetooth 5.2 protocol, with better energy management and connectivity features.

2. Key Insights

Realme 9i:

  • Strengths: The Realme 9i stands out with its faster 33W charging and a more compact design. It includes a charger in the box. The inclusion of a dedicated black and white camera adds a unique dimension for creative photography. The Hi-Res Audio provides very good audio quality.
  • Competitive Advantages: Its lower price point may be more appealing to budget-conscious buyers.
  • Trade-offs: The 9i has a less capable processor, an older display technology (IPS LCD), and less powerful camera hardware compared to the M53.

Samsung Galaxy M53:

  • Strengths: The Galaxy M53 boasts a superior AMOLED display, a much more powerful processor, a higher-resolution main camera with a larger sensor, and it can record 4K video. It has a Wide Angle lens as well as a portrait depth sensor. Dolby Atmos also offers great audio quality.
  • Competitive Advantages: Its higher processing power is ideal for gaming, video editing, and other resource-intensive tasks. The advanced AMOLED display makes media consumption and gaming much more enjoyable.
  • Trade-offs: The Samsung has slightly slower charging at 25W. It also comes without a charger in the box which is annoying. The Galaxy M53 is also slightly larger and heavier and has no expandable storage.

3. User Profiles and Recommendations

Realme 9i:

  • Best Suited For: Users who are on a tight budget but still want a dependable smartphone with decent battery life. Those who value the speed of charging over raw processing power will appreciate the 33W charging, and a charger included in the box.
  • Use Cases: Good for everyday tasks, social media browsing, basic photography, and media consumption.
  • Price-to-Value: It’s positioned as a budget-friendly phone, offering a good balance between features and affordability.

Samsung Galaxy M53:

  • Best Suited For: Users who prioritize performance, display quality, and camera capabilities. Ideal for gamers, content creators, and anyone who wants a more premium experience.
  • Use Cases: Excellent for gaming, high-quality photography, video recording, and media consumption. Suitable for resource-intensive applications.
  • Price-to-Value: While it may cost more than the 9i, it offers a more premium experience with its advanced display, powerful processor, and versatile camera system.
